You can also set up a couple of custom levels for your specific preferences. Various default options are available, including bright, excited, mellow, relaxed, vocal, treble boost, bass boost, speech, and manual. I have it set to 15 seconds (labeled as standard), but there are options for five seconds (short), 30 seconds (long), or no automatic closure.īelow this section is the equalizer area with an option for boosting the bass as well. You can choose when to have the music start playing again or choose to turn off the automatic feature. My wife and daughters often walk into my office when I am working, and over the past week, I just started speaking to have the Sony earbuds pause the music. You can choose from automatic, high, or low sensitivity to voice detection, which may be helpful if you like to sing along to your music. This function is very useful for those who work from home when they may want to speak with other family members without having to remove their earbuds. You can use a slider to control the ambient sound level and toggle on the focus on voice option in the ambient sound settings.īelow the sound control settings, we find the ability to enable or disable the Speak-to-Chat option. If noise canceling is selected, then the automatic wind noise reduction option can also be toggled on or off. Moving along to the Sound tab, we find the ability to choose noise canceling, ambient sound, or off.
